The Met Office have issued a yellow weather warning in Cumbria for today (July 10). 

Heavy showers and thunderstorms leading to a chance of some flooding and disruption in places are likely in much of Cumbria, and into Scotland. 

Heavy showers and thunderstorms are expected to break out today, mainly during the afternoon. Some places will miss these, but where they do occur, 15 to 25 mm rain may fall in less than an hour with a small chance of one or two spots seeing up to 40 mm in two hours, leading to a chance of localised flooding.

Lightning strikes will be an additional hazard. The showers and thunderstorms will steadily ease during the evening.

The Met Office says that there is a good chance driving conditions will be affected by spray, standing water and/or hail, leading to longer journey times by car and bus.

Some flooding of a few homes and businesses is possible, leading to some damage to buildings or structures.

Delays to train services are possible.
